What is a Casino Crypto Coin?
A casino crypto coin is a digital asset, frequently developed on a blockchain like Ethereum, Binance Smart Chain, or Solana, designed specifically for usage within a betting community. Unlike general-purpose c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in or Ethereum, these tokens are frequently utility-based. They are crafted to assist in faster deals, lower costs, and offer special advantages to the user base of a particular platform or decentralized autonomous organization (DAO).
These coins move beyond easy currency exchange. They frequently act as internal "commitment points" that have real-world monetary worth, allowing holders to participate in governance, access VIP benefits, or get a share of the casino's earnings.
Why Casinos are Pivoting to Crypto
The transition toward cryptocurrency is not merely a trend; it is a tactical transfer to fix some of the most consistent concerns in online gaming.
1. Boosted Privacy
Conventional banking techniques require users to offer substantial personal and financial data. Casino Crypto Online Casino coins assist in pseudonymous play, where users just need a digital wallet address to deposit, play, and withdraw.
2. Provably Fair Gaming
Blockchain innovation permits "provably fair" systems. Utilizing cryptographic hashing, players can independently validate that the outcome of every spin, card draw, or dice roll was figured out randomly and was not controlled by the platform.
3. Worldwide Accessibility
Fiat currency transfers are often subject to regional banking restrictions or long processing times. Cryptocurrencies run on a worldwide, borderless network, enabling users from virtually anywhere to participate without the interference of intermediaries.

When a user buys or utilizes a native casino token, they are generally looking for more than just a betting chip. The most successful casino crypto tasks incorporate their tokens into the wider platform experience through several unique energies:
- Discounted Transaction Costs: Many platforms waive withdrawal costs or offer lowered betting house edges if the user uses the native token.
- Staking Rewards: Holders can "lock" their coins into a wise contract to make passive yield, effectively earning a share of the platform's day-to-day revenues.
- Governance Participation: Token holders are typically offered ballot rights, enabling them to get involved in choices such as the addition of brand-new video games, platform upgrades, or community-driven treasury allowances.
- VIP Access and Multipliers: High-volume players can leverage their token holdings to open higher withdrawal limitations, committed account supervisors, and exclusive high-stakes tables.
The Risks: What Players Should Know
While the benefits are considerable, the world of casino crypto coins carries dangers that users need to navigate carefully.
- Market Volatility: The value of a native casino token can vary significantly. Unlike fiat chips, the worth of your bankroll can decrease (or boost) no matter your success in the real games.
- Regulatory Uncertainty: The legal status of Crypto Slots Casino gambling is in a state of flux worldwide. Gamers ought to guarantee they are running within the laws of their jurisdiction.
- Smart Contract Vulnerabilities: While blockchain is safe, the code governing the casino's wise agreements might contain vulnerabilities. Constantly research the platform's audit history before depositing big amounts.
- Platform Legitimacy: The barrier to entry for introducing a crypto casino is low. It is vital to perform due diligence on the developers, the liquidity of the token, and existing user reviews.

3. How can I validate that a game is "provably reasonable"?
Many modern-day crypto gambling establishments provide a "hash" for every single bet. You can input this hash into an independent third-party confirmation tool to confirm that the outcome was generated randomly by the algorithm and not changed after your bet.
4. What occurs if the casino goes offline?
If you hold your funds in a private wallet, you are safe. Nevertheless, if your funds are kept in the casino's internal account, you may lose access if the platform closes down. Always withdraw profits to your personal wallet frequently.
